Enhancing Your Shop’s Exterior
The exterior of your shop is the first thing potential customers will see, and it’s essential to make an excellent first impression.
From ensuring you keep the front of your shop free from mess and rubbish to using eye-catching signage, paying attention to the areas of your store your customers see first can help you to make the right changes and give you hot spots to focus on.
Clean windows, accessible doorways and enticing displays all play a part in making an excellent first impression. Showcase offers, new products, seasonal items and media to make your store more appealing to customers.
Creating an Inviting Entrance
What turns you away from a store before you enter it? Is it a dirty doorway? Uncleanedwlecome mats? Broken handles or windows? All of these and more? Avoiding these common mistakes can help you to create a welcoming entrance.
A clean welcome mat, no obstructions, having a door greeter and using heat or air-con to control the temperature can all enhance the customer experience upon entry. Something else to consider is scent marketing. Scent marketing is an excellent way to create an inviting atmosphere. Use scents associated with your brand or products to create a memorable customer experience. This could include using scented candles or diffusers to create a relaxing and inviting atmosphere.
Showcasing Your Products Effectively
Whether you are having a full window display for clothing or product or creating an enticing display directly opposite the entrance with your best offer, having appealing items in view of the entrance can work wonders in bringing in customers.
Make sure your displays are bright, clean, well-signed and capable of capturing people’s attention for the right reasons.
Using Colors and Lighting to Your Advantage
Colours and lighting are potent tools that can be used to create a welcoming and inviting atmosphere in your shop. Here are three strategies to use colours and lighting to your advantage:
- Use Warm Lighting
Warm lighting is an excellent way to create a relaxing and inviting atmosphere. Use warm lighting in your shop to create a cosy and inviting environment that will keep customers shopping longer.
- Use Colours to Create a Mood
Colours can be used to create a mood in your shop. Use colours that align with your brand and products to create a mood that will resonate with customers. For example, blue is associated with calmness and relaxation, while red is associated with excitement and energy.
- Use Lighting to Highlight Products
Lighting can be used to highlight products and draw attention to them. Use spotlights or other forms of lighting to highlight your best-selling products. This will attract customers’ attention to these products and increase the likelihood of a purchase.
